I've been reading through the tutorials for audacity and JAWS.  It seems
pretty straight forward, except I'm really struggling to select audio
and play the selection back.
 
The tutorial says to use the left and right brackets to choose the start
and end points of the piece you want to select, but I don't think it's
working for me.  When I try and play the selection back it just plays
the whole track.  Where am I going wrong?
